if _resolve("background_publish_enabled"):
# Submit to background thread pool, copying context so that
# contextvars (user_id, session_id, etc.) are preserved.
ctx = contextvars.copy_context()
executor = _get_background_executor()
executor.submit(
ctx.run,
_upload_and_publish_trace,
current_trace,
resolved_pipeline_id,
prompt,
on_flush_failure,
)
logger.debug("Trace submitted to background executor for publishing")
# Bounded by a semaphore so a slow/unreachable backend can't
# cause traces to accumulate in the executor's (unbounded)
# work queue and exhaust memory (OPEN-11984). When the queue
# is full, we drop the trace rather than block the caller.
semaphore = _get_background_queue_semaphore()
if semaphore.acquire(blocking=False):
ctx = contextvars.copy_context()
executor = _get_background_executor()
future = executor.submit(
ctx.run,
_upload_and_publish_trace,
current_trace,
resolved_pipeline_id,
prompt,
on_flush_failure,
)
future.add_done_callback(lambda _f: semaphore.release())
logger.debug("Trace submitted to background executor for publishing")
else:
logger.warning(
"Openlayer background publish queue is full (max %d "
"pending traces); dropping trace for step '%s' instead "
"of buffering it in memory. This usually means the "
"Openlayer backend is slow or unreachable. Consider "
"checking connectivity, raising "
"background_publish_max_queue_size, or setting "
"background_publish_enabled=False for synchronous "
"publishing.",
_resolve("background_publish_max_queue_size"),
step_name,
)
